Preferred Label : Buciclovir;

NCIt synonyms : 2-Amino-9-(R)-3,4-dihydroxybutyl-9H-purin-6(1H)-on; (R)-9-(3,4-Dihydroxybutyl)guanine; BCV;

NCIt definition : An acyclic guanosine analog with activity against herpes simplex virus (HSV). Buciclovir is phosphorylated to its triphosphate form by HSV thymidine kinase in infected cells and acts as a specific inhibitor of the viral DNA polymerase. It is incorporated into both RNA and DNA but only inhibits DNA synthesis.;

UNII : 4G4Z4676IS;

InChIKey : QOVUZUCXPAZXDZ-RXMQYKEDSA-N;

CAS number : 86304-28-1;

Chemical formula : C9H13N5O3;
